Latest update:

Once you've obtained a feedback score of 100 or higher (that's 10 excellent feedbacks as a seller), you will qualify for instant credits upon shipment of your outgoing games. You'll no longer have to wait for feedback before you get your credits.

If you already have 100 feedback as of this post, your account is enabled for this already.

For anyone reaching 100 feedback in the future, I need to review individual accounts and authorize them for this to take effect, in order to prevent scams. You can contact me on VGFive via the "Contact Us" box to let me know that your account qualifies and is ready for review.
 
One more update for today:

We now support trading digital codes for full games. You can trade codes from Steam, PSN, XBLA, and pretty much any other platform now. Offers and requests need to be specified as digital codes or "digital code acceptable," respectively.

I'm trying to process shipping via the Paypal link and it asks me how much the package weighs. I'm sending out God of War 2 so the game weighs more thanks to the 2nd disc.

How do you determine weight without going to the post office?
 
[quote name='Cage017']I'm trying to process shipping via the Paypal link and it asks me how much the package weighs. I'm sending out God of War 2 so the game weighs more thanks to the 2nd disc.

How do you determine weight without going to the post office?[/QUOTE]

I generally weigh my packages at home in an effort to avoid the PO as much as possible. I bought a cheapo $5 electronic scale from Hong Kong which took forever to arrive but is spot on for accuracy; it has paid for itself multiple times over. Amazon.com often lists a title's weight; God of War Saga is listed as 4oz, for example, and as a game I recently sent out on VGFive, that sounds about right (no manual, 2 discs). If you're willing to wing it, I'd say 90% of my shipments fall between 4-6oz, so just put 6 or 7 oz on there and you'll likely be overpaying. Weighing it would be best, however.
